XPMeter

Lightweight XP/hour tracker for Classic Era: session, overall, current level and previous level, plus time-to-ding and a level-up announcer.

Description

XPMeter is a tiny, no-fuss XP/hour tracker for WoW Classic Era. One small draggable box, no config screens, no libraries, no bloat.

What it shows

  • Session: xp/h since you logged in
  • Overall: xp/h across the character's whole tracked history
  • Current level: xp/h for the level you're on right now
  • Previous level: xp/h for the level you just finished, so you can see whether your new zone or spec is actually faster
  • To level: estimated time until your next ding at the current session rate

Level-up announcer

When you ding, XPMeter tells everyone how long that level took, in the form "XPMeter: Ding! Level 23. That took me 1h 42m." In a party or raid it posts to group chat; when solo it posts to /say. Turn it off with /xpm announce.

Commands

  • /xpm shows or hides the window
  • /xpm reset resets the session
  • /xpm resetall wipes all saved data for this character
  • /xpm pause pauses or resumes the timer (handy while AFK in town)
  • /xpm announce toggles the level-up announcement
  • /xpm test previews the announcement

Data is saved per character. The timer stops at level 60. Drag the box anywhere; its position is remembered.
